Nobody's Rib: Pat Stevens, Liz Sweeney, Babette, and Some Other Women You Know

Rate this book
A collection of characters, sketches, and short takes from the actress and former "Saturday Night Live" star includes pieces from SNL as well as never-before-seen material

191 pages, Paperback

First published August 1, 1991

I thought that this was going to be a memoir. Then I started to read it and I thought it was just going to be some of her characters and then some essays. Then I started to read it and when it was just in character monologues, well at least it's short. I admit the only characters I knew going into this were Pat Stevens and Babette, but this was a weird format for a book.
One star for the Pat Stevens part, one star for the Mr. Rogers essay at the end.
